Product Marketing Lead - Risk Applications
The Role
We are hiring a Product Marketing Lead to own product marketing for our Risk Applications and Enabling Services portfolio, the products our customers depend on for AML screening, transaction monitoring, payment screening, fraud detection, case management, and regulatory reporting. This is the largest and most active half of our product portfolio, with new products and features shipping continuously. You'll take ownership of each product wherever it is in its lifecycle.
You will report to the VP of Product Marketing and be one of two Product Marketing Leads building out a newly-forming function. This is a foundational hire, with real latitude to shape how product marketing operates at ComplyAdvantage. You will partner closely with the Product Director who owns this portfolio, translating a steady stream of product and feature launches into positioning, enablement and go-to-market execution that Sales and Customer Success actually use.
We run a structured, phased launch process that's still evolving and you'll help shape it as you go, deciding what's genuinely differentiated and worth a moment, and what ships quietly as a release note.
This role has no direct reports today. It is a hands-on, individual-contributor role for someone who wants to own outcomes end to end rather than manage other people's output; someone who can take ambiguous input from Product and Sales and turn it into sharp positioning and a launch that lands, without needing a team underneath them to get there.
What You Will Do
Own product marketing for Risk Applications & Enabling Services. You are responsible for positioning, messaging, launch execution and enablement for this portfolio, end to end, from early roadmap conversations through GA and beyond.
Take ownership of products at every stage. Some products in this portfolio are newly launched or launching soon; you'll pick up their ongoing positioning, enablement and buyer narrative rather than starting from a blank page, and build out what's missing.
Lead launches end to end. Decide what earns a flagship moment versus what ships quietly, and own the launch plan, messaging and positioning brief for the releases that matter most.
Build the enablement Sales actually uses. Sales decks, demos, battlecards and FAQs written from a real understanding of the buyer and competitive landscape, not templated from a brief.
Contribute to competitive intelligence and win-loss. This is shared across the Product Marketing team for now; you'll help build the muscle until we have dedicated coverage.
Represent UK/EMEA (and APAC in the interim) market context. You're the voice of our primary market in company positioning, even as we build out dedicated regional coverage over time.
Partner with Product without owning their roadmap. You influence priorities through evidence, buyer feedback, competitive dynamics, win-loss signal, not through authority. You operate as a peer to a Product Director, not a downstream recipient of their decisions.
Use AI in your own work. We expect Product Marketing to use AI-assisted workflows for research synthesis, competitive analysis, and first-draft positioning and content. This is how we work, not an aspiration.

What Success Looks Like
At 60 days: You understand the Risk Applications and Enabling Services portfolio end to end, including any products that have recently launched or are approaching launch, and where our competitive and buyer knowledge has gaps. You've built working relationships with the Product Director for this portfolio, Sales leadership and Customer Success, and can articulate what's differentiated in our portfolio and why it matters to a buyer.
At 4 months: You are running launches independently through the tiered model. Your highest-priority products have positioning and a sales narrative that Sales trusts and uses, and your enablement materials are the ones reps actually reach for. You've built a first cut of the win-loss picture for your portfolio and can speak to it with data, not anecdote.
At 8 months: Your portfolio's go-to-market motion is measurably working; Sales can point to deals your positioning and enablement helped win. You're a trusted, senior voice in cross-functional planning for this portfolio, and you're operating at a level that could reasonably take on more scope as the team grows.
